我正在尝试从IIS7下的ASP.NET应用程序中写入日志文件,但一直收到以下异常:
UnauthorizedAccessException "Access to the path 'C:\Users\Brady\Exports' is denied."
有人建议我使用来帮助解决这个问题,但它是一个相当复杂的工具,我真的没有时间去探索它。请有人可以帮助我,并建议如何使用PM来确定哪个用户正在尝试访问文件夹等。
我有一个类需要ApplicationUser (从ASP.NET标识)。实例应该是当前用户。
public class SomeClass
{
public SomeClass(ApplicationUser user)
{
目前,我要做的是从Controller注入当前用户:
var currentUser = await _userManager.GetUserAsync(User);
var instance = new SomeClass(currentUser);
现在,我想使用Microsoft提供的依赖注入。我不知道如何将ApplicationUser添加到服务中
Castle Windsor不允许包含重复实现类型的注册。它允许,这意味着只要注册一次,就可以将实现类型映射到多个服务类型。
ASP.NET vNext的库需要为多个服务类型注册相同的实现类型。但是,这些服务类型也具有不同的生命周期,如图中所示的。
public static IEnumerable<IServiceDescriptor> DefaultServices()
{
var describer = new ServiceDescriber();
yield return describer.Transient<IFakeService, Fake
我正在实现一个使用Youtube Data API v3的iOS应用程序。为了获得OAuth访问令牌,我打开了中指定的Google OAuth 2.0Auth页面。
我看到的Google帐户登录表单包含电子邮件和密码字段,但没有为那些还没有Google/Youtube帐户的用户提供“创建帐户”链接。我需要支持用户可能没有Google/Youtube帐户的场景,并且我希望为他们提供创建Google/Youtube帐户作为身份验证流程的一部分的机会。
是否有一些选项可用于启用“创建帐户”链接?